VBQA3102N Product details

Product introduction:

VBQA3102N is a dual N-type field effect transistor suitable for a variety of application scenarios. It has a drain-source voltage of up to 100V, a gate-source voltage of 20V and a gate-slot voltage of 1.8V, as well as excellent performance Features. Drain-source resistance is 22mΩ at VGS=4.5V and 18mΩ at VGS=10V, suitable for a wide voltage operating range, using Trench technology to provide better power efficiency and reliability.

**parameter:**
- **Configuration:** Double N type
- **Drain-Source Voltage (VDS):** 100V
- **Gate-source voltage (VGS) (㊣V):** 20V
- **Gate slot voltage (Vth):** 1.8V
- **Drain-source resistance (m次) at VGS=4.5V:** 22m次
- **Drain-source resistance (m次) at VGS=10V:** 18m次
- **Drain current (ID):** 30A
- **Technology:** Trench (groove type)
- **Package:** DFN8(5X6)-B
